What color is BE42CE?

The RGB color code for color number #BE42CE is RGB(190, 66, 206). In the RGB color model, #BE42CE has a red value of 190, a green value of 66, and a blue value of 206.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 7.8% cyan, 68.0% magenta, 0.0% yellow, and 19.2%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 293.1° (degrees), 58.8 % saturation, and 53.3 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#BE42CE has a hue of 293.1° (degrees), 68.0 % saturation and 80.8 % brightness/value.

What is the LRV of BE42CE?

Color code BE42CE has an LRV of nearly 19. By LRV value, it is a medium dark color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).

Monochromatic Color Palette

Monochromatic colors belong to the same hue angle but different tints and shades. Monochromatic color palette can be generated by keeping the exact hue of the base color and then changing the saturation and lightness.

Analogous Color Palette

Analogous colors are a group of colors adjacent to each other on a color wheel. Group of these adjacent colors forms Analogous color scheme Palette. Analogous Palette can be generated by increasing or decreasing the hue value by 30 points.

Triadic Color Palette

The triadic color palette has three colors separated by 120° in the RGB color wheel

Tetradic Color Palette

The tetradic colour scheme composed of two sets of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.
